Wondering if anyone can please help with maternity and annual leave.

I work for the nhs (part some) and I am due my baby April 13th 2020 so im currently 21 weeks pregnant.
I have been trying to decide when to start maternity pay and was originally thinking trying to go as far to the end as I can even though I am struggling already !
I think that I still accure my annual leave whilst I'm off on maternity leave that can be added on to the end ?
I have currently booked all this year's holiday using it to reduce my 12 hour shifts which takes me to the middle of January and I am 29 weeks in the last week of January which is when I can first start maternity leave from. Like I said above I was going to try and push myself until March but I am now thinking if i do that then I will loose out on alot of annual leave when I return in march 2021? As I would only have a month to use my holiday up. I'm sorry if this doesn't make sense hoping someone can gather what I'm trying to ask which is would I be better going on mat leave at end of January 2020 (29 weeks) and ending it in January 2021 then adding holiday on the end? Then I would go back the end of March? Is this correct ? Really hope this makes sense

Not quite got the full sense of your post, but just wanted to clarify that yes, you do still accrue holiday whilst on mat leave. And I would do which ever arrangement means you get maximum time with baby

Sorry if I’ve missed but how many hours / shifts do you do currently? If it is 3 shifts per week, can you take some leave in Feb so it is only 2 shifts? You won’t actually lose any leave, however you take it but the sooner you start the less time you will actually have with the baby.

You could ask your employer if you would be bound by the same annual leave year rules when returning from maternity leave. If you’re worried that you wouldn’t have time to use it all when you get back, I don’t think you can lose it in these circumstances.
